Output 4d66df667792cfc78ae251e52492188a0dc99e5dfd0db6c2c35ca959cfefeccf:0

value
115000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5753969c57a1203465831fe0a75ec13630fb0d79 OP_EQUAL
address
39ekr3wXFcBK2FubDWMFRDxWUnyJhYsT1g
transaction
4d66df667792cfc78ae251e52492188a0dc99e5dfd0db6c2c35ca959cfefeccf
confirmations
59109
spent
true